Analysis
The most recent figure for share of primary-school-age children who are out of school vs. gdp per capita in Syrian Arab Republic is 21.8%, measured in 2024.
That represents a change of down 17.2% on the previous year and down 39.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, share of primary-school-age children who are out of school vs. gdp per capita in Syrian Arab Republic peaked at 35.9% in 2013 and was at its lowest, 0.9%, in 2011.
Syrian Arab Republic ranks 29th of 203 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
Children of primary school age (typically 6–11 years) not enrolled in any level of education, expressed as a percentage of all children in that age group.
